The Punjab State Farmers’ & Farm Workers’ Commission (PSFC), headquartered at Kalkat Bhawan, SAS Nagar (Mohali), Punjab, is an autonomous body established by the Government of Punjab with the objective of promoting the sustainable growth of agriculture and improving the socio-economic well-being of farmers and farm workers across the state.
Punjab has long been recognized as one of India's leading agricultural states, making significant contributions to the nation's food security. As agriculture continues to evolve with changing climatic conditions, market dynamics, natural resource constraints, and technological advancements, the Commission plays a vital role in developing forward-looking policies and practical solutions that support the farming community.
The Commission serves as an advisory institution that conducts in-depth research, field studies, policy analysis, and stakeholder consultations to identify the challenges faced by farmers and farm workers. Based on scientific evidence and extensive consultation, it provides recommendations to the Government of Punjab on matters related to agricultural development, rural livelihoods, and resource management.
